Ideal Substrates for Toadstool Production

Selecting the best medium is vital for successful fungi production. Several options are present, each with its specific benefits . Popular choices include hay which offers good aeration and is often easily affordable . Timber sawdust provide a more compact medium suitable for specific varieties and provide great feeding value . Coconut coir is also commonly used due to its large water holding and pH qualities. In conclusion, the most suitable base depends on the specific mushroom species you are growing .

  • Straw
  • Timber Pellets
  • Coco Fiber
